STEAM-Based Puzzles:

The puzzles mix a variety of STEAM (science, technology, engineering, arts, math) challenges to exercise different parts of the brain, including mazes, tessellations, logic and math reasoning, crosswords, word searches, and language codes. When solved, the puzzles’ answers (at the back of the book) reveal facts about Oregon’s flora, fauna, history, and culture. Experienced Puzzle Book Creator:

Jen Funk Weber is an experienced puzzle book creator, who began publishing puzzles in 1997 and has had hundreds published in books and magazines. Wide Variety of Audience Appeal:

Perfect for long drives, plane rides, meals, and other slow times, The Puzzler’s Guide to Oregon keeps young puzzlers ages 8 and up occupied and engaged. Buyers interested in natural history, STEM topics, and environmentalism will be excited to find this interactive puzzle guide that will entertain—and educate—young learners for hours.

Jen Funk Weber is a writer, professional puzzle maker, traveler, gardener, and natural history guide. She has created and published hundreds of puzzles and activities for kids of all ages for books and magazines for almost 30 years. She lives with her husband in a house they built overlooking the Matanuska Glacier in Alaska.
